Supp. regimen looks good, but you're going to be EXTREMELY overtrained if you're not, already. Five days of weights a week is ok if you're advanced and have great recovery ability, but it would bring a lot of ppl into an overtrained state.

As far as cardio, I don't think anyone at all would recommend 12 cardio sessions per week. At that rate, you'll be burning up a ton of muscle and probably weaking havoc on your joints, inviting overuse injuries.

I don't know how someone would have the time to eat or even hold a full time job w/ this training schedule. I would say if you're cutting, start cardio low and build up to 3 or 4 days a week. Most ppl. will say 5 is too much, if you're trying to not lose a lot of muscle.
